On Fri, Dec 9, 2011 at 11:57 AM, Yarrow Madrona <amadrona at uci.edu> wrote:
> I am having trouble with Phaser not writing out my ligands (HEME and small
> molecule) to it's output PDB even though they are in the input PDB. I am
> running through the GUI using Phenix version 1.7.3-921. Phenix refine
> recognizes HEME from the CCP4 library I think so I am not sure why I at
> least do not get a HEME in the output PDB.  Thanks for your help.

Phaser ignores anything named HETATM - the original reason being to
throw out water molecules (which should never be included in an MR
model).  I think this limitation may be removed once it is switched to
using the same PDB parser as phenix.refine et al., but you can get
around it for now by changing HETATM to ATOM, e.g.:

sed 's/HETATM/ATOM  /;' model.pdb > model2.pdb
